Getting Rammus doesn't mean auto win, but if you don't like Rammus ban him first or get kiters/CC/magic damage. I think this applies to each champ. Poppy can be countered with people who hit harder at lower health (Pantheon for instance).
Each of the top picks/first bans can be countered, but the majority of people do not think they are fun to build against. I've seen Teemo with sweeper invalidate both ap and ad shacos. The shrooms cleverly placed prevent back doors and the Shaco becomes like an Eve who either team fights or makes the match a 4v5(hurting their own team).
I ban Shaco for instance, because unless I know all 5 people on my team I can't expect that the logical person will go stop Shaco when it counts instead of running around stupidly in the wrong place.
I ban Ahri because I personally hate what she does to team fights. I know people who ban Blitz because they hate what he does to team fights. When I know everyone on my team knows how to dodge Ahri and Blitz's skill shots... we don't ban them (and in fact try to get them at champ select).
TLDR: Rammus ban is about personal and team play style, and the majority of people do not like fighting a champ who has so much CC, speed, and armor when the current popular meta is tanky physical dps.
